On 18 January, a person with a positive nucleic acid test was detected in Chaoyang District, Beijing.

According to reports, this person with a positive nucleic acid test is named Yue Mouxian, from rural Henan, temporarily living in No. 558, Shigezhuang Village, Pingfang Township, Chaoyang District, and his main work is: carrying decoration materials.

According to reports, in the 18 days from January 1 to January 18, Yue Mouxian's footprints covered Dongcheng, Xicheng, Chaoyang, Haidian, Shunyi and other districts, and he worked odd jobs in more than 20 different locations, and often worked until the early morning, known as the hardest Chinese in the flow.

It is also reported that in recent years, Yue Mouxian has been renting a house in Weihai, Shandong Province, with his wife and young son, and his wife usually mainly helps others to dry kelp, while Yue Mouxian usually works as a crew member in Weihai. Although the couple's income is not high, there is still no problem in coping with living expenses.

So, why did Yue Mouxian come to Beijing to work?

Yue Mouxian's wife, Li Mouying, told reporters that the main purpose of his husband Yue Mouxian's work in Beijing was to find his eldest son who went missing on August 12, 2020.

Li Mouying said: "My eldest son is called Yue Yuetong, and at the age of 19, he has been working in Dongshan, Weihai. On August 12, 2020, he suddenly disappeared. On the day of his disappearance, I also transferred money to him through WeChat, and at the same time, he told me in WeChat that he was going to take the bus to see me, but I did not wait for him. Next, I couldn't contact him again. ”

Li Mouying continued: "In order to find my son, my husband Yue Mouxian quit his job as a crew member and went to Shandong, Henan, Hebei, Tianjin and other places. However, I never got any news about my son. ”

Li Continued: "Since my son used to work as a cook in Beijing, my husband decided to go to Beijing to look for his son. You know, it costs a lot of money to find a son, which is why my husband works so hard in Beijing. ”

According to media investigations, Yue Mouxian's work in Beijing is mainly "content" of carrying sandbags, cement or transporting construction waste to designated garbage stations, which are very dirty and tiring work, very hard.

So, where did Yue Mouxian's eldest son go?

According to the news released by the Rongcheng City Public Security Bureau in Shandong Province, Yue Yuetong, the eldest son of Yue Mouxian, had drowned and died on the day of his disappearance.

The Rongcheng Municipal Public Security Bureau said in the news released that at about 18:00 on August 12, 2020, Yue Mouxian's wife Li Mouying reported that her son Yue Yuetong disappeared at about 9 o'clock on the same day. The public security organs did not find any clues by retrieving surveillance video and visiting and investigating. On August 26, 2020, a mass found the body of a male who had become highly corrupt in a local pond. Through DNA comparison and related identification, the public security organs finally confirmed that the male body, which was already highly corrupt, was Yue Yuetong, the eldest son of Yue Mouxian. However, Yue Mouxian and his wife did not agree with this appraisal result, and they always believed that their son was still alive. At present, the body of Yue Yuetong, the eldest son of Yue Mouxian, is still stored in the funeral home.
